Obituary for Patricia Lou Grubbs Williams

Patricia Lou Grubbs  Williams
Patricia L. "Pat" Williams, 84, of Suffolk, Virginia, passed away on November 28, 2016. She was born in Tulsa, Oklahoma on December 22, 1931 to the late Charles F. and Lena V. Grubbs. Pat graduated from Cradock High School in Portsmouth, Virginia. Besides her parents, she was preceded in death by her daughter, Kathi Hill. Pat worked as an office manager for Kempsville Building Materials for about 15 years before moving to Nags Head, North Carolina to pursue her passion of being an artist, painting mainly Outer Banks scenery. She resided with her life-long friend, Anne Berry in Nags Head for many years until she moved to Suffolk in February 2016 to live with her son and his wife.
Pat is survived by her son, Tim Williams and his wife, Suzie; grandchildren, Angela Williams Tucker, Christie Harris, Benjamin Williams, and Van Hill; great-grandson, Austin Williams; and a host of other family and friends. The family wishes to express their gratitude to Pat's care team at Lake Prince Woods in Suffolk and the medical team at Sentara Norfolk General Hospital for their kindness and care during her illness.
